UK increases all visa and citizenship fees
The UK Home Office has announced that all visa and citizenship application fees will increase from April 8.
Under the new rates, a visit visa for up to six months will increase by £6 to £135, a two-year visit visa by £31 to £506, a five-year visit visa by £55 to £903, and a ten-year visit visa by £69 to £1,128.
Academic visit visas for 6-12 months will increase by £14 to £234, with private medical treatment visas increasing at the same rate. Transit visa fees will rise by £2.5 for airports and £4.5 for land borders.
Electronic Travel Authorisation (ETA) fees will increase by £4. Visa fees for those entering the UK as victims of torture in their home country will rise by £197.
For skilled worker sponsorship applications from outside the UK, fees will rise by £50 for up to three years and £99 for over three years. For skilled healthcare workers, fees will increase by £20 for up to three years and £38 for over three years. Seasonal worker application fees will rise by £21.
Student visa fees for applicants and their dependants will increase by £34 to £558. For skilled worker sponsorship applications from within the UK, fees will rise by £58 for up to three years and £114 for over three years. Additionally, the fee for extending visit visa durations has been increased by £72.
